Appearance
A dark palette of colors on a black textolite. Surprisingly, the minimum concentration of RGB per square centimeter. Just a small logo on the heatsink of the I/O panel, and the wording “GAMER” to the right of it.
Many people will thank you for this, and if this issue is important, then you should not be upset. The motherboard has three Addressable Gen 2 pads and an AURA RGB_HEADER.
The manufacturer took care of the presence of mounting holes under CO for LGA 115x/1200, and this significantly expands the list of compatible coolers, which gives either greater freedom of action, or allows the user to keep his old cooler for the new platform.
Lotes LGA 1700 socket. The operational slots are unremarkable.
The power subsystem is designed according to the 16+1 scheme and is controlled by the Digi+ ASP2100 PWM controller.
Two high-quality radiators are responsible for cooling. Fastening — on bolts.
The motherboard can take on board up to three M.2 drives, each of which will be covered by a radiator on top.
The M.2_1 conductive slot will also provide cooling on the back side of the drive.
The scheme for connecting NVMe drives is as follows:
- M.2_1 works in PCI-E 4.0 x4 mode, designed for 2242/2260/2280/22110 drives. Connected to the CPU.
- M.2_2 works in PCI-E 4.0 x4 mode, designed for 2242/2260/2280/22110 drives. Connected to the chipset.
- M.2_3 works in PCI-E 3.0 x4 mode, designed for 2242/2260/2280 drives. Connected to the chipset.
No M.2 SATA support. A nice bonus is that all slots are equipped with Q-latch, which will allow you to install and remove the drive with bare hands.
This is what their cooling elements look like:
The Intel B660 chipset is cooled by a small radiator. It is fixed with screws, and contact with the crystal is provided by a thermal gasket.


The audio zone is separated from the main part of the board, the Realtek ALC4082 chip is responsible for the sound.
Intel I225-V (2.5G Ethernet) is responsible for the wired network, and Intel AX201 serves Bluetooth and Wi-Fi.
Now about pads and the like. The CMOS battery is located slightly to the left under the first PCI-E slot, and is very likely to be covered by the graphics card. At the bottom left are: HD_AUDIO pin, 4-pin fan connector, AURA RGB_HEADER pin, ADD_GEN2, COM_DEBUG pin, two USB 2.0 pins, Thunderbolt connector, and T_Sensor thermocouple connector.
On the bottom right are two four-pin connectors for the fan, the front panel pad. There are four SATA ports at an angle of 90 degrees. To the right are the USB 3.0 (USB 3.2 Gen 1) and USB 3.2 Gen 2 (Type-C) blocks. At the top there is also a zone of LEDs for POST indication, two RGB blocks and two four-pin connectors for fans.


A plug is installed on the I/O. From the specific you can find the CLR_CMOS button, the button and the LED of the BIOS FlashBack function. Of the usual connectors, the following are located here:
- x1 HDMI v2.1;
- x1 DisplayPort v1.4;
- x2 USB 2.0 (Type A);
- x4 USB 3.2 Gen 1 (Type A);
- x1 USB 3.2 Gen 2 (Type A);
- x1 USB 3.2 Gen 2 (Type C);
- x1 USB 3.2 Gen 2×2 (Type C);
- x1 RJ-45 (2.5G);
- x5 Mini Jack (Line in, Line out, Mic in, C/SUB, Rear);
- x2 SMA (for connecting the Wi-Fi antenna).
